What is a PEB Shed?

A Pre-Engineered Building (PEB) shed is a steel structure built over a structural concept of primary, secondary members, and cover sheeting connected to each other. These components are pre-designed and fabricated in a factory, then assembled on-site.

Key Features:

  • Speedy Construction: PEB sheds can be erected much faster than conventional buildings, reducing construction time by up to 50%.
  • Cost-Effective: With optimized design and material usage, PEB sheds can be more economical than traditional structures.
  • Flexibility: They offer flexibility in design, allowing for future expansions.
  • Durability: PEB sheds are designed to withstand harsh weather conditions and seismic activities.

1. Speed of Construction

Time is money, and PEB sheds save both. The components are manufactured off-site and simply assembled on-site, significantly reducing construction time. 


2. Cost Efficiency

PEB sheds are designed to optimize material usage, reducing waste and overall costs. Additionally, the reduced construction time translates to lower labor costs.


3. Design Flexibility

Whether you need a warehouse, factory, or showroom, PEB sheds can be customized to meet specific requirements. Their modular nature allows for easy expansion or modification.


4. Durability and Strength

Made from high-quality steel, PEB sheds are resistant to corrosion, pests, and fire. They are also designed to withstand extreme weather conditions, ensuring longevity.


5. Sustainability

PEB sheds are environmentally friendly. The steel used is recyclable, and the construction process generates less waste compared to traditional methods.

Real-World Applications

PEB sheds are versatile and can be used in various sectors:

  • Industrial: Factories, warehouses, and workshops.
  • Commercial: Showrooms, offices, and retail spaces.
  • Agricultural: Storage for equipment, grains, and livestock.
  • Recreational: Sports arenas and community halls.
